Position Summary
Occupational Therapist / OT position at Orlando Health Lake Mary Outpatient Rehabilitation Services, Longwood, FL.
Department: LMH Outpatient Rehab Svs
Status: Day Shift | Variable Full Time (36 hours per week)
Shift: Monday - Friday
Title: Occupational Therapist / OT
Location: 521 W State Road 434 Ste 204, Longwood, FL 32750
- Treat injured, ill, or disabled patients through therapeutic use of everyday activities to develop, recover, and improve skills for daily living and work.
- Evaluate patients, gathering data from patients, physicians, interdisciplinary team meetings if available, family and other sources.
- Develop treatment plans integrated with continuum of care with specific goals and objectives.
- Demonstrate knowledge and skills appropriate for age of patients served on assigned caseload.
- Assess data reflective of patient status and interpret appropriate information to identify each patient’s requirements relative to their age‑specific needs; provide care as delineated in departmental policies and procedures.
- Demonstrate competency in use, care, and maintenance of profession‑specific equipment, observing safety precautions and providing verbal explanations.
- Re‑evaluate and modify treatment plans and goals as appropriate; prepare written documentation as required.
- Recognize and communicate when patient has received optimal benefit from therapy.
- Ensure complete documentation and accurate billing.
- Adhere to State Practice Act and Standards of Practice.
- Provide patient/family education as indicated.
- Maintain reasonably regular, punctual attendance consistent with Orlando Health policies, ADA, FMLA, and other standards.
Education / Training:
- Bachelor’s degree or higher from an approved occupational therapy program.
Licensure / Certification:
- Current Occupational Therapist license in the State of Florida (temporary permit acceptable).
- Current BLS/Health Care Provider certification.
Experience:
- Open to newly licensed or tenured OTs.
